Scholarships for Medical Students Abroad 2026: Complete Guide for Indian Students

Pursuing MBBS, MD, MS, or postgraduate medicine abroad offers world-class training, global exposure, and better career prospects—but costs can exceed ₹1–2 crore+ (especially in USA, UK, Canada, Australia). In 2026, scholarships help Indian students offset tuition, living expenses, travel, and insurance. Fully funded options are rare for undergraduate MBBS (more common for PG/residency), but partial to substantial funding exists via government schemes, bilateral programs, and foundations.

This 2026 guide focuses on top scholarships for Indian students studying medicine abroad (MBBS/MD/MS), including fully funded/partial in popular destinations (South Korea, Hungary, Turkey, Germany, China, Russia, UK, USA). Updated as of March 2026—many deadlines ongoing or approaching for 2026-27 intakes.

Why Scholarships for Medical Students Abroad Matter in 2026

  • High costs: MBBS in USA/UK/Canada often $50,000–$100,000+/year; affordable in Russia/China/Philippines but still need aid.
  • Limited full funding for MBBS: Most “fully funded” are for PG (MD/MS) or government-subsidized in Asia/Europe.
  • For Indians: Focus on return-to-India plans (NMC recognition), strong NEET scores, academics (80%+ in 12th), and leadership.
  • Post-study: Scholarships boost residency matching, global practice, or Indian service.

Top Scholarships for Medical Students Abroad 2026 (Indian Focus)

Scholarship NameCountryLevel (MBBS/MD/MS)Funding & BenefitsEligibility Highlights (Indian Applicants)Deadline (2026-27 Cycle)Key Notes
Global Korea Scholarship (GKS)South KoreaMBBS/MD/MSFully funded: Tuition + stipend + airfare + 1-year Korean language trainingStrong academics; embassy recommendation; NEET qualifiedFeb–March 2026 (embassy track)High acceptance; English/Korean programs; top for medicine
Stipendium Hungaricum ScholarshipHungaryMBBS/MDFull tuition + stipend + accommodation + insuranceMerit-based; Indian eligible; NEET requiredNov 2025–Jan 2026 (extended cycles)Popular for MBBS; English-medium; high NMC recognition
Türkiye Scholarships (İbni Sina)TurkeyMBBS/MD/MSFull tuition + stipend + accommodation + Turkish prep + healthMerit; age limits; NEET qualifiedFeb–May 2026Fully funded; prep year; strong for Indian students
Chinese Government Scholarship (CSC)ChinaMBBS/MD/MSFull tuition + stipend (~¥3,000/month) + accommodationGood academics; NEET; embassy/university applyFeb–April 2026Affordable; English programs; many slots for Indians
Russian Government ScholarshipRussiaMBBS/MDTuition waiver + maintenance (15,000+ grants)Merit + country quota; NEETVaries (embassy)Subsidized; low cost; English/Russian options
DAAD ScholarshipsGermanyMD/MS (PG)Stipend €934–1,200/month + travel + insurance (tuition often free)Strong academics/proposal; NEET + German/EnglishVaries (Oct–Dec/early 2026)PG focus; tuition-free unis; rare for UG MBBS
Commonwealth ScholarshipsUKMD/MS (PG)Full tuition + stipend + airfareUpper second-class; development impact; NEETOct–Dec (CSC)For PG medicine; leadership focus
Fulbright-Nehru Master’s/DoctoralUSAMD/MS (PG)Full tuition + stipend + airfare + insurance55%+ bachelor’s; work exp; leadershipClosed for 2026; next ~May 2026PG/research; competitive; cultural exchange
JN Tata EndowmentUSA/UK/EuropeMD/MS (PG)Loan-scholarship up to ₹10 lakhMerit; Indian; high academicsMarch–April (tentative)Widely used for medical PG abroad
National Overseas Scholarship (NOS)VariousMD/MS (PG)Full tuition + maintenance + travelSC/ST/EWS; income ≤₹8 lakh; NEETRolling/March–JuneGoI scheme; category-specific

Other notables:

  • Inlaks Shivdasani (USA/UK/Europe): Up to $120,000; merit/leadership; for PG medicine.
  • State-specific (e.g., Dr. Ambedkar Overseas Vidya Nidhi for SC/ST from Telangana/AP): Partial/full for abroad medicine.
  • University waivers: Merit-based in Hungary/Turkey/China (10–50% off after first year).

USA/Canada specifics: Full scholarships rare for international MBBS/MD (high competition); focus PG/residency via Fulbright or uni need-based (limited).

Step-by-Step: How to Apply for Medical Scholarships Abroad 2026

  1. Qualify Basics — Clear NEET (mandatory for abroad MBBS recognition in India); strong 12th marks; English proficiency (MOI/Duolingo often accepted).
  2. Research — Check wemakescholars.com, shiksha.com/studyabroad, leapscholar.com for lists; official sites (studyinkorea.go.kr, studyinhungary.hu).
  3. Secure Admission — Many require uni offer first (apply via embassy/university portals).
  4. Prepare Docs — Transcripts, NEET scorecard, passport, SOP (India impact), recommendations, income/category proofs (need-based).
  5. Apply — Embassy route (GKS, CSC, MEXT-like) or direct (Stipendium, Türkiye); free portals.
  6. Interviews — Embassy/university panels—focus on motivation, service plans.
  7. Visa — Scholarships aid; prove funds if partial.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Skipping NEET—invalidates India practice.
  • Assuming full funding for USA MBBS—rare for internationals.
  • Generic SOPs—tailor to health impact/India needs.
  • Missing deadlines—early 2026 common.
